Understanding CVE-2018-3132
This CVE identifies a vulnerability in Oracle PeopleSoft Products, affecting PeopleSoft Enterprise PeopleTools versions 8.55 and 8.56.
What is CVE-2018-3132?
The vulnerability allows an unauthenticated attacker with network access to compromise PeopleSoft Enterprise PeopleTools, potentially impacting other products. Successful exploitation could lead to unauthorized data manipulation and breaches of confidentiality and integrity.
